Soil Fertility Status of the Two Eruptions of Mount Tangkuban Parahu and Mount Tampomas in Tanjungsari District Sumedang Regency

Abstract

Soil fertility is one of the important factors to optimize plant growth and productivity. This study aims to analyze the status of soil fertility through soil physical analysis (texture) soil chemistry (pH H2O and KCl, C-organic, cation exchange capacity, base saturation, P2O5, and K2O) in several land units of Tanjungsari District, Sumedang Regency. The method used to determine sample points is purposive sampling method by considering several land units, namely soil type map, soil parent material map, topography map (slope), land use map, and rainfall data. Soil fertility status is determined by the matching table method between the results of soil chemical analysis with soil fertility status index that refers to the Soil Research Center (PPT) 1995. The results of the matching table data analysis showed that the research area almost entirely included low fertility status criteria except for the pine forest land unit on a moderately steep slope including medium fertility status criteria. The factors of base saturation, k-potential (K2O), and C-organic are the limiting factors of soil fertility status in the Tanjungsari District of Sumedang Regency, including the low to medium category.
